If you’re traveling with another person, divide both of your belongings between both bags. That way you’ll each  have some of your belongings if one bag goes missing. If you’re checking luggage on a plane, bring a separate carry-on bag with 1-2 days’ worth of clothes, plus all essentials like medicine, toiletries, and travel documents.

The next step up is the Magna Cart, which is quite popular worldwide and has lots of glowing customer reviews. It has a carrying capacity of 150 lbs/68 kg , solid aluminum construction, and 5-inch (12.7 cm) rubberized wheels. If you’re willing to carry just a bit more weight and bulk, the standard Samsonite Luggage Cart is a great choice. Its platform is a bit larger, which gives it more stability in order to prevent tipping if you’re moving fast with an unwieldy load.
